Alt-pop singer morgxn has teamed up with Grammy Award-winning artist Sara Bareilles to share an emotional reimagination of his hit song, ‘WONDER’.

morgxn’s new version of the track, ‘WONDER’, with Sara Bareilles follows the indie pop artist’s remix EP, WONDER [reimagined], released late last year.

The original version of ‘WONDER’, released last summer, was a viral TikTok success with over 25 million views across the app as well as over 50 million streams worldwide.

morgxn explains,

“With this version I feel like it became more intimate and, in a way, much deeper. Like a conversation between two artists in different places who understand and live in the journey. I am so grateful that she joined me to share these words. Coming out of this last year there is still a lot of healing and wondering to do—but at least it feels nice to know I’m not alone in it.”

Sara Bareilles adds,

“I was moved by morgxn’s story as an artist and the path he has taken. It’s brave and I admire his guts and independence. His voice is already such a striking part of his great talent, and this song is about seeking a place of belonging as our truest and most authentic selves. I felt compelled to contribute to that message, especially as I think about the larger LGBTQ+ community during this month of Pride and wanting to celebrate that sense of belonging to ourselves and our communities…it was a joyful collaboration.”

Released earlier this year, morgxn’s MERIDIAN: vol 1 EP has seen massive support across Asia, where the album continues to garner streams in Indonesia, the Phillippines, Malaysia, and Singapore.

Coming from a particularly tumultuous time in March 2020, the EP was shaped by a 24 hour period where morgxn experienced the highest of highs and the lowest of lows. As the word entered lockdown, morgxn was dropped by their record label of five years, leaving them devastated.
